How Joan Rivers' Net Worth at Death Actually Works
Joan Rivers' net worth at death was a reflection of her impressive career, which spanned over five decades. Her wealth was primarily generated through a combination of successful stand-up comedy tours, television appearances, and endorsement deals. As a pioneering female comedian, Rivers was one of the first to break into the male-dominated industry, paving the way for future generations of female comedians.
Her income streams included:
- Stand-up comedy tours and performances
- Television shows, including her own talk show and various guest appearances
- Endorsement deals with major brands
- Merchandising and licensing agreements
- Book sales and publishing royalties

What Was Joan Rivers' Net Worth at the Time of Her Passing?
According to various sources, Joan Rivers' net worth at the time of her passing was estimated to be around $150 million. This figure is a testament to her remarkable career and her ability to build a lasting legacy.
